| dcterms.abstract | This demonstration showcases a verifiable multi-chain querying system. The proliferation of blockchain-driven applications has created a demand for on-chain data analysis across multiple blockchains. However, existing solutions face challenges in seamlessly integrating with existing blockchains, maintaining compatible with various database engines, and ensuring the integrity of query results. In response, we develop a blockchain indexing system that utilizes a novel verifiable virtual filesystem (V2 FS) for query authentication. Our demonstration focuses on highlighting the key features of our system, including blockchain data indexing, verifiable multi-chain query processing, and the usability and performance of our solution. Additionally, we provide an interactive visualization module to enhance attendees' understanding and insights. | - |
